Callaway County, Missouri, USA



 


Notes:
Callaway County is a county located in the U.S. state of Missouri. It is part of the Jefferson City, Missouri Metropolitan Statistical Area. As of 2000, the population was 40,766. Its county seat is Fulton.



The county was organized in 1820. It was named for Capt. James Callaway, a grandson of Daniel Boone. Callaway was killed in Indian fighting in 1815.
